Crystal Palace chairman Steve Parish has hit out at reports he was sluggish to make a move for now Watford head coach Marco Silva, saying he had been "begged" to see him by the Portuguese man's agent.

The Daily Mail has published claims Silva was left unimpressed by a request from parish Parish, asking the 39-year-old not to talk with other clubs before the Eagles head returned from holiday.

If true, this happened when Silva was already in discussion with Watford, and supposedly only strengthened his desire to take over at Vicarage Road.

But Parish has since taken to Twitter to dispute the reports - and said Silva's agent had requested a meeting with him, only to sign a contract with Watford the following day.

At the time of Silva's appointment, it was understood there had been no contact from South London regarding the role at Selhurst Park.
